What is MAPP Eligibility Worksheet
The Medicaid Purchase Plan Eligibility Worksheet is a healthcare form used by residents of Wisconsin to determine eligibility for the MAPP program, which provides health coverage to individuals with disabilities.

What is the Medicaid Purchase Plan Eligibility Worksheet?
The Medicaid Purchase Plan (MAPP) Eligibility Worksheet serves a critical function for individuals with disabilities in Wisconsin. This form assesses various factors to determine eligibility for the MAPP program, which is essential for accessing adequate health coverage. Key components of the worksheet include personal information, financial details, and disability status, all of which contribute to the eligibility evaluation.

Eligibility Criteria for the Medicaid Purchase Plan
To qualify for the MAPP in Wisconsin, applicants must meet specific eligibility criteria. Financial criteria include income limits and asset assessments, while non-financial criteria include particular disability requirements. Understanding these MAPP eligibility criteria is essential for ensuring a successful application and compliance with Wisconsin Medicaid eligibility standards.

What are the eligibility requirements for the MAPP program?
To qualify for the MAPP program, individuals must meet specific income and asset limits, along with having a documented disability. Detailed eligibility criteria can be found on the Wisconsin Medicaid website.

What supporting documents do I need to complete the form?
Necessary supporting documents typically include income verification, asset statements, and proof of disability. Ensure all documents are current and legible to facilitate the eligibility determination process.

How long does it take for my eligibility to be processed?
Processing times can vary based on workload and accuracy of submitted information, but generally, you can expect an update within 30 days of submission. Follow up with your local Medicaid office for specific inquiries.
What should I do if my eligibility is denied?
If your MAPP eligibility is denied, you have the right to request a fair hearing. Comprehensive reasons for denial will be provided, and you can appeal the decision through official channels outlined in your eligibility notice.
